DNC Elects Ken Martin as Chair

By    |   Monday, 03 February 2025 10:20 AM EST

Seeking new leadership as President Donald Trump's second White House term begins, the Democratic National Committee elected Ken Martin as its chair.

MSNBC reported that Martin was elected on Saturday afternoon to replace outgoing chair Jaime Harrison.

"The Democratic Party is the party of working people, and it's time to roll up our sleeves and outcompete everywhere, in every election, and at every level of government — and I look forward to working with this next generation of leadership to build a party to unite America," Martin said in his acceptance speech.

"Today's elections mark a new chapter in DNC leadership, and Donald Trump and his billionaire allies are put on notice: we will hold them accountable for ripping off working families, and we will beat them at the ballot box," he said.

Martin, who served previously as Minnesota party chair and DNC vice chair, was reportedly a top contender for the position along with Wisconsin Democratic Party chair Ben Wikler and former Maryland Gov. Martin O'Malley.

The bids of other candidates, including Faiz Shakir, Bernie Sanders' former presidential campaign chief, and Marianne Williamson, a self-help author, were considered unlikely and MSNBC reported that Williamson wound up endorsing Martin in her nominating speech on Saturday.

During the first round of voting, Martin handily beat his opponents, receiving 246.5 votes, while Wikler, who was backed by Sen. Chuck Schumer, D-N.Y., and Reps. Nancy Pelosi, D-Calif., and Hakeem Jeffries, D-N.Y., garnered 134.5 votes, according to reports. O'Malley came in third with 44.

While campaigning for the role, Martin had painted himself as the candidate who could rebuild the party's image in the minds of voters and do what it takes to resist Trump.

"My job is to get out there and define the Republicans," he said at the time, according to MSNBC. "We will go on offense against Donald Trump."

The intra-party election comes as Democrats grapple with the blistering pace of Trump's first few weeks back in office and follows the loss of both chambers of Congress and the presidency in November.

As DNC chair, Martin will be responsible for fundraising and allocating political donations, as well as for helping to develop a winning message and strategy for Democrats as they seek to recover from the disappointment of the 2024 election cycle.
